How Angola e-Invoicing Runs Through Microsoft Power Apps

  • App Generates the Billing Record: The moment a billing record is created inside a custom Power Apps solution built for your business, Advintek’s connector retrieves that transaction directly for Angola processing.
  • Fiscal Standards Checked: The invoice then passes through validation, measured against everything Angola’s tax authority requires before it can proceed.
  • Whatever Structure, Mapped to JSON: Regardless of how your custom app shapes an invoice, Advintek maps every field into the JSON schema AGT mandates.
  • Restricted Access, Fully Logged: The invoice then travels an access-restricted, fully logged route toward submission.
  • Cleared With the Authority: Filing goes out through AGT’s approved transmission channels, holding compliant no matter which internal app generated the record.
  • Stored to the Legal Standard: Cleared invoices are archived to match Angola’s five-year retention requirement.

Can a Power Apps solution manage Angola's AGT requirements on its own?

No — Power Apps has no built-in connection to AGT’s clearance system or its JSON schema, so a connector such as Advintek is needed regardless of how the app is built.
